修改样式无法两种情况,全局样式修改,局部样式修改
下面我就已一个按钮组件为例子来写个demo
特点: 虽然你是在当前目录下的less或css文件修改了,但是全局生效的,建议如果有全局修改的需求,放到global.less的文件中修改,并做好注释。
如:我这边修改按钮组件的样式
注意:这里就要提到css modules的一个类名加载机制了,上面应该看到了,最外层有个类 为 lqDemo ,因为css modules 的机制是,如果你不使用它,那就不会进行加载。所以无论如果需要在外面加上一个class类,进行使用,否则仅仅引用是不会生效的
这个时候就需要用到css的作用域了
像这样嵌套在:global下就好了
哈哈哈 是不是就解决了,其实还有其它的方式,但我觉得这种方式是最好的
先贴个官网的图片
然后说说整体流程...
然后重新 npm i
再重新运行,就解决了
奉上参考资料
Vue-cli3.0配置全局less
vue antd 按需加载 报错.bezierEasingMixin()
Quasar(发音为/kweɪ.zɑɹ/)是MIT许可的开源框架(基于Vue),可帮助Web开发人员创建:响应式网站PWA(Progressive Web App)通过Apache Cordova构建移动APP(Android,iOS,…)多平台桌面应用程序(使用Electron)Quasar允许开发人员编写一次代码,然后使用相同的代码库同时部署为网站、PWA、Mobile App和Electron App。使用最先进的CLI设计应用程序,并提供精心编写,速度非常快的Quasar Web组件。当使用Quasar时,你不需要像Hammerjs,Momentjs或Bootstrap这样的额外重型库。它拥有这些功能,而且体积很小!